This workshop aims to bring together researchers and practitioners to discuss the latest advances and challenges in representation learning under limited-resource settings. We focus on innovative approaches for learning with scarce data, labels, modalities, and computing resources, including self-supervised, semi-supervised, few-shot, and synthetic data-driven methods.
- Recognition, generation, reconstruction, any visual/multi-modal tasks in limited situations
- {Self, Semi, Weakly, Un}-supervised learning with very limited resources
- {Zero, One, Few}-shot learning with very limited resources
- Training convnets, transformers, diffusion, foundation models with relatively fewer resources
- Synthetic training with procedural, artificially generated images

Most content updates only require editing JSON files in src/data/ — no code changes needed.
| What to update | File |
|---|---|
| Title, dates, overview, CFP, schedule, contact | src/data/workshop.json |
| Organizers, invited speakers | src/data/people.json |
| Past events, awards, supporters | src/data/extras.json |
| SEO metadata, OGP | src/lib/seo.ts |
| Color palette | src/app/app.css |
| Navigation links | src/components/header.tsx |
| Footer links | src/components/footer.tsx |
To show/hide sections (e.g., Program, Invited Speakers), comment out or uncomment the corresponding blocks in src/app/routes/Home.tsx.
